1 <br /> 2 In addition,Three Rivers Park District may have acquired the land along the <br /> 3 Baker Park Reserve Alternative with Land and Water Conservation funds. If <br /> 4 such funds were used, Land and Water Conservation rules and regulations will <br /> 5 apply to the Company's acquisition of an easement for the proposed <br /> 6 transmission line. Property acquired and/or developed using Land and Water <br /> 7 Conservation funds may not be wholly or partly converted to other than public <br /> 8 outdoor recreation uses without the approval of the National Park Service <br /> 9 pursuant to 36 CFR § 59.3 of the Land and Water Conservation Fund Act. <br /> 10 <br /> 11 Q.
